Design Principles for Harmonizing Functionality and Aesthetics

Achieving a harmonious balance requires an understanding of design principles that bridge functionality and aesthetics. Key principles include consistency, simplicity, visibility, and feedback.

Consistency

Consistency in design involves maintaining a uniform look and feel across all parts of an application. This consistency helps users intuitively understand how to interact with an application since similar elements behave similarly. Consistent use of colors, typography, and layout structures contributes to both functionality and aesthetic harmony.

Simplicity and Clarity

Simplicity is integral to good design. By minimizing the amount of information presented at any given time, users are less likely to feel overwhelmed. Clear labeling, whitespace, and straightforward navigation contribute to simplicity, making the application easy to use while enhancing its aesthetic appeal.

Visibility and Accessibility

Designing with accessibility in mind ensures that an application is usable by everyone, including individuals with disabilities. This involves creating high-contrast visuals, using alt text for images, and designing a keyboard-friendly navigation system. Accessibility is not only a functional requirement but also aligns with ethical design practices.

Feedback for User Interaction

Feedback in web design refers to providing users with visual or auditory signals that their actions have been acknowledged. This can be as simple as a button changing color when clicked or a notification appearing when an action is completed. Feedback is essential in guiding user behavior and enhancing the interaction experience.

User-Centered Design

User-centered design (UCD) focuses on integrating user feedback throughout the design process. This involves understanding user needs, behaviors, and limitations through research methods such as surveys, interviews, and usability testing. UCD ensures that the application meets the end user’s requirements effectively.

Responsive and Adaptive Design

Responsive design ensures that a web application looks and functions well on all devices and screen sizes. This fluid approach uses flexible grids and layouts. Adaptive design, on the other hand, consists of creating several fixed layouts that respond to specific screen sizes. Both methodologies strive for optimal user experience and aesthetic consistency.

Prototyping and Testing

Prototyping allows designers to explore ideas quickly and test them against user expectations. It involves creating low-fidelity wireframes and high-fidelity mock-ups that simulate the application’s user interface. Testing these prototypes with real users provides insights into usability and highlights areas for improvement.

Web Development Frameworks

Frameworks such as Angular, React, and Vue.js provide a foundation for developing complex applications with streamlined functionalities. These tools enhance efficiency in coding, allowing developers to focus more on fine-tuning the aesthetic aspects of the application.

Advanced CSS Techniques

CSS has evolved to include advanced techniques such as Flexbox and Grid, which allow for intricate page layouts that enhance visual appeal without compromising usability. These techniques enable precise alignment, spacing, and responsive design capabilities that are crucial for aesthetic quality.

Integrated Design and Development Environments

Tools like Figma, Adobe XD, and Sketch have integrated environments where designers and developers can collaborate smoothly. These platforms allow for real-time edits and provide a single source of truth for design assets, ensuring that functionality and aesthetics are aligned throughout development.
